I. Introduction


1. Comcast residential proxy refers to the use of residential IP addresses provided by Comcast, a popular internet service provider, for proxy purposes. These proxies act as intermediaries between the user's device and the internet, allowing for increased privacy, security, and anonymity.

2. There are several reasons why you may need a Comcast residential proxy. Firstly, they offer better security compared to other types of proxies. Residential proxies use IP addresses associated with real residential devices, making it difficult for websites to detect and block them. This ensures that your online activities remain secure and protected from potential threats.

Additionally, Comcast residential proxies provide stability and reliability. Since these proxies use residential IP addresses, they are less likely to get blocked by websites that employ anti-proxy measures. This ensures uninterrupted access to websites and services without any disruptions.

Moreover, Comcast residential proxies offer increased anonymity. By using a residential IP address, your online activities are masked, making it challenging for websites to track your location and identity. This is particularly useful for tasks like web scraping, online research, and bypassing geo-restrictions.

A. How to Configure Comcast Residential Proxy

Configuring Comcast residential proxy involves the following steps:

1. Proxy settings: In the proxy software, locate the settings or configuration options. Depending on the provider, there may be options to set the proxy type, port number, and authentication credentials.

2. IP rotation settings: Some providers offer the option to configure IP rotation, where the proxy IP address automatically changes at specified intervals. Adjust the settings according to your needs.

3. Whitelist or blacklist URLs: Depending on your requirements, you may be able to specify URLs to whitelist or blacklist. Whitelisting allows access only to specified URLs, while blacklisting restricts access to specific URLs.

B. What recommendations can optimize proxy settings for specific use cases when using Comcast residential proxy?

Optimizing proxy settings for specific use cases can enhance performance and ensure the best results. Consider the following recommendations:

1. Speed vs. security: If speed is crucial for your use case, choose a provider that offers fast connections. However, if security is a priority, opt for a provider with robust encryption protocols.

2. Location selection: Determine the locations you need proxy IP addresses from. Some providers offer a wide range of residential IP addresses across different regions and countries.

3. Session persistence: For tasks that require session persistence, such as web scraping, choose a provider that offers session persistence capabilities. This ensures that the same IP address is used consistently throughout the session.

4. Proxy rotation frequency: Adjust the IP rotation settings based on your requirements. Higher rotation frequency may be beneficial for tasks that require anonymity, while lower frequency may be suitable for tasks that require IP persistence.
